Which Key Documents Must You Prepare for Your Home Loan Application?

Organised desk in Beaufort West office showcasing stacked loan documents under warm sunlight.

Successfully navigating the home loan application process in Beaufort West requires a thorough understanding of the necessary documentation. Organising your paperwork meticulously is essential for a smooth application experience. The primary documents you will need often include proof of income, bank statements, and relevant details about the property you intend to purchase. By collecting these documents in advance, you can significantly reduce the chances of delays and complications during your application process. Below is a comprehensive list of essential documents to gather prior to starting your application:

  • Proof of income (such as payslips or tax returns)
  • Employment verification letter
  • Bank statements for the last three months
  • Identity document (ID)
  • Property details (including deed of sale or offer to purchase)
  • Credit report
  • Proof of additional income (if applicable)
  • Affordability assessment documentation

How Do Loan Terms Affect Interest Rates?

The duration of a home loan, often referred to as the loan term, significantly impacts the interest rates presented by lenders in Beaufort West. Shorter loan terms generally attract lower interest rates, but they also require higher monthly repayments, making them suitable for borrowers who can comfortably manage larger payments. Conversely, longer loan terms usually result in higher interest rates but lower monthly payments, appealing to those prioritising cash flow over total interest costs. Understanding these dynamics assists borrowers in making informed choices that align with their financial capabilities.

How Do Down Payment Amounts Relate to Loan Rates?

The size of the down payment significantly influences interest rates for entry-level homes in Beaufort West. A larger deposit can reduce the overall loan amount and lessen the perceived risk for lenders, often resulting in more favourable interest rates. For instance, making a down payment of 20% or more can lead to considerable savings over the life of the loan. In contrast, smaller deposits may lead to higher interest rates, reflecting the additional risk to lenders. Grasping this relationship is vital for first-time buyers aiming to secure the best possible terms.

What Tax Advantages Are Associated with Home Loans?

Utilising tax benefits related to home loans can provide significant financial relief for homeowners in Beaufort West. Homeowners can often deduct mortgage interest payments from their taxable income, resulting in substantial savings. Comprehending these benefits allows borrowers to optimise their financial situations and fully exploit the advantages that home loans offer in South Africa.

What Hidden Costs Should You Be Aware of in Loan Agreements?

Hidden fees within home loan agreements can surprise many borrowers in Beaufort West. Commonly overlooked charges include application fees, valuation fees, and early repayment penalties. Conducting thorough research and asking lenders about potential fees can ensure you make informed decisions, allowing you to comprehend fully the financial implications of your loan agreements.

What Steps Should You Take After Finalising Your Home Loan?

What Procedures Must You Follow After Approval?

Once you secure a home loan in Beaufort West, several important post-approval procedures are essential for a smooth transition. The first step involves completing the property transfer process, which typically requires the assistance of a conveyancer to facilitate the legal transfer of ownership. Borrowers should also ensure that all necessary insurance policies are in place, protecting their investment and fulfilling lender requirements.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Is the Minimum Deposit Required for a Home Loan in Beaufort West?

The minimum deposit typically required for a home loan in Beaufort West generally ranges from 10% to 20% of the property's purchase price, although this can differ based on the lender and specific loan products.

How Long Does It Take to Process a Home Loan Application?

The processing time for a home loan application in Beaufort West can vary from a few days to several weeks, depending on the lender and the specifics of your application.

Can I Apply for a Home Loan with Poor Credit?

While it is indeed possible to apply for a home loan with poor credit, it may result in higher interest rates or potential rejection. Improving your credit score before applying can enhance your chances of securing approval.

What Additional Costs Should I Consider When Purchasing a Home?

Beyond the home loan itself, buyers should account for expenses such as transfer duty, legal fees, home insurance, and maintenance costs, as these can significantly impact the overall budget.

Are First-Time Buyers Eligible for Special Loan Programs?

Yes, first-time buyers in South Africa may qualify for special loan programmes, including government-backed schemes that offer reduced deposit requirements and attractive interest rates.

How Can I Improve My Chances of Loan Approval?

To enhance your chances of obtaining loan approval, maintain a good credit score, provide proof of stable income, and ensure that your debt-to-income ratio remains within acceptable limits.

What Distinguishes Fixed from Variable Interest Rates?

Fixed interest rates remain constant throughout the entire loan term, while variable rates fluctuate according to market dynamics, which can affect monthly payments and total interest paid over the loan's duration.

Is It Possible to Renegotiate My Loan Terms After Approval?

Yes, borrowers can renegotiate loan terms after approval, especially if their financial circumstances change. It is essential to communicate with your lender to explore available options.

What Are the Consequences of Missing a Loan Payment?

Missing a loan payment can incur late fees, harm your credit score, and potentially lead to legal action from the lender. It is crucial to communicate with your lender to arrange a payment plan if difficulties arise.

How Can I Determine If I'm Prepared to Purchase a Home?

You are ready to buy a home if you have a stable income, a strong credit score, adequate savings for a deposit, and a clear understanding of your budget and housing needs.
